Deck Replacement Service in Seattle, WA
Deck replacement services involve removing an existing deck structure and installing a new, updated deck in its place. This project typically covers various types of decks, including wood, composite, or other materials, and can be tailored to suit different styles and property layouts. Homeowners often seek deck replacement when their current deck shows signs of significant wear, damage, or deterioration, or when they want to upgrade to a more durable or modern design. Before requesting this service,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, the materials available, and any potential impact on outdoor living space during the replacement process.
Property owners should consider factors such as the size and design of the new deck, the condition of the existing structure, and any local building codes or permits required for installation. It’s also helpful to clarify the differences between repairing a deck and replacing it entirely, as well as to explore options for customization and material choices. Understanding these aspects can ensure the project aligns with personal preferences, budget, and property requirements, leading to a successful deck replacement.

Common Deck Replacement Service Jobs
Deck Replacement - involves removing and installing a new deck structure to improve safety and appearance.
Wood Deck Replacement - replaces aging or damaged wood decks with durable, weather-resistant materials.
Composite Deck Replacement - upgrades existing decks with low-maintenance composite materials for long-lasting performance.
Partial Deck Replacement - addresses specific sections of a deck that are deteriorated or damaged.
Deck Board Replacement - focuses on swapping out broken or rotting boards to restore deck integrity.
Railing and Stair Replacement - updates safety features with new railings and stairs for enhanced security and style.
Deck Replacement Service Questions
What are common reasons to replace a deck? Decks may need replacement due to rotting, warping, or extensive damage that affects safety and stability.
How can I tell if my deck needs replacing? Signs include loose boards, persistent rot, mold growth, or structural issues that cannot be repaired effectively.
What types of materials are used for deck replacement? Common options include pressure-treated wood, composite materials, and cedar, depending on durability and aesthetic preferences.
Is deck replacement suitable for any property? Deck replacement can enhance safety and appearance on most residential properties, especially when existing decks show significant wear.
